Output 671b666ab61d03bbdb93edd72b0be84d1a8cba95c0b1507b6292ec9dd3aceb54:15

value
42441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 950c6db7eac7b503bce78a60a309f05b0c48752a OP_EQUAL
address
3FH7VgPQkqRbB28miHfdx4tvKKewMbH9Ji
transaction
671b666ab61d03bbdb93edd72b0be84d1a8cba95c0b1507b6292ec9dd3aceb54
spent
true